Filipino Nurse Appointed to CGFNS Post

A Bicolano nurse was recently appointed as Director of Credentials Evaluation Services of CFGNS. Becoming the first Foreign Educated Nurse to join its leadership team full-time of the world’s largest credentials evaluation organization for nursing and the healthcare community.

Jasper Tolarba, DNP, RN, NEA-BC comes well prepared with more than 20 years in varied and progressive roles in nursing and is CGFNS’ first doctoral prepared nurse with Six Sigma Lean Certification to join the leadership team.

Jasper obtained his MSN degree with focus in nursing administration from Xavier University in Cincinnati and his undergraduate degree in nursing from Bicol University in the Philippines. He is certified as an adult critical care nurse by AACN and also works as an adjunct nursing professor at Sacred Heart University–Cambridge Campus. He graduated as an outstanding university student for service, having served as editor-in-chief of the Bicol University publication.

Jasper was also rewarded as a Brueggeman Fellow by Xavier University for his work on intercultural beliefs affecting health care decisions. Jasper has a Doctorate in Nursing Practice (DNP) in Leadership and Policy from Yale University in New Haven, CT.

His professional experience includes working as the Clinical Nursing Director at Tufts Medical Center in Boston, MA.
